The Psychiatric Mental Health Nurse Practitioner is responsible for providing comprehensive professional culturally linguistically and age-appropriate care in a correctional setting. This position will be responsible to diagnoses conduct therapy and prescribe medication for patients who have psychiatric disorders medical organic brain disorders or substance abuse problems.

Responsibilities will be but not limited to:

  • Provide psychiatric services psychosocial and physical assessment of patients treatment plans and mange patient care;
  • Work as member of the multidisciplinary team while also providing medical providers with consults for mental health issues as needed and collaborating with medical providers as needed;
  • Establish diagnoses order and interpret studies perform and monitor therapeutic procedures assess and/or manage follow up care;
  • Prescribe and regulate medications relative to the patients health care needs;
  • Record and document health appraisal data in a timely and accurate manner necessary to maintain and/or coordinate required services;
  • Communicate findings of mental healthcare assessments diagnostic tests etc. to patients physicians and other health care providers in a timely manner and/or as determined by DOC policy and clinical standards;
  • Develop provide and systematically re-evaluate the plan of treatment for patients;
  • Make appropriate referrals for patients when appropriate services are not within the DOC Clinical Services scope of practice for Behavioral Health;
  • Provide assessment consultation and brief intervention for psychological/psychiatric problems and/or disorders;
  • Maintain documentation of patient encounters via progress notes assessment/diagnostic information and treatment planning as outlined in DOC policy and clinical standards;
  • Maintain necessary NP registration/licensure as required by South Dakota state law;
  • Know understand and ensure adherence to the organizations policy related to the patients right for confidential care and HIPAA;
  • Perform other tasks/duties as assigned.

Conditions of Employment:

The SD DOC is committed to a work environment free from illegal drugs and alcohol. All job offers are contingent upon successful completion of a background investigation urine drug screen (UDS) and the candidates ability to perform the essential functions of the position.

Individuals selected for the position will have the opportunity to carry Oleoresin Capsicum (OC/pepper spray) if desired. If OC spray is carried the staff carrying OC spay will be required to have direct (level 1) exposure during the training program. Individuals selected for the position must successfully complete a written and practical self-defense exam and successfully complete CPR to AHA guidelines - this includes successful completion of the practical/hands on portion as well as the written exam. Selected individuals must possess the physical ability to successfully complete the practical self-defense exam which involves the following:
  • lift arms above head and kick as high as own waist;
  • stabilize another person to accomplish a controlled take down;
  • use arms palms of hands and feet to deliver blows;
  • withstand impact (slow speed or with a safety bag) on own body from strikes/blows;
  • rotate body 90 degrees with feet planted for striking with foot or using a defensive tactic;
  • get down on one or both knees and up again with multiple repetitions.

Additionally TB (tuberculosis) screening is required of all new employees upon hire.
